Casse croute is the spot if you're craving authentic French vibes in London. The cote a bouef à partager is a solid choice for meat lovers, while the Gateaux crepe and Riz au lait for dessert are sweet bites that make your taste buds sing. The daily-changing menu keeps things fresh but might leave vegetarians twiddling their thumbs. Staff like Kevin make sure you’re well looked after, even if they're not winning any awards for warmth.
The atmosphere is cozy and brasserie-like, with a charming ambiance that feels like a mini getaway to France. Don’t expect a massive menu, but the quality shines through—just like the chocolate in their desserts. Overall, it’s a reliable pick for a good meal without the drama. Perfect for a date night or a special treat.
